An order to accept the provisions of M.G.L. c. 140, § 139(c).

The city approves a state option to waive dog license fees for residents aged 70 and older. Senior dog owners would still need to license and vaccinate their dogs, and late fees or kennel licenses are not affected.

Key provisions

§1 Accepts M.G.L. c. 140, § 139(c) allowing waiver of dog license fees.
§2 No fee shall be charged for a dog license for residents aged 70 years or older.
§3 Waiver applies only to dog license fees; late fees and kennel licenses remain unaffected.
§4 Qualifying residents still must license and vaccinate their dogs per local requirements.
